In December 1976, Frank Zappa performed four sold-out shows at New York City's Palladium.  The career-spanning concerts were "theatrical, outrageous, and raucously funny," according to Ruth Underwood, who played percussion and synthesizer for the dates.  The performances, she says, were "filled with startling and gorgeous music, dating from Frank's 1960s output to literally the moment the curtain went up." Originally released in 1989, the Lynyrd Skynyrd compilation Skynyrd's Innyrds: Their Greatest Hits was certified 5x platinum by the RIAA and helped bring the Southern rockers' hits to a new generation of fans.  The album collects classics like "Sweet Home Alabama,"

Next month, Gordon Lightfoot's "Sundown" celebrates the 45th anniversary of its single release.  The tune marked the first Hot 100 No. 1 hit for the Canadian folk, folk-rock, and country singer-songwriter.  On March 1, Real Gone Music will anthologize this period of Lightfoot's career with the release of the 2-CD The Complete Singles 1970-1980.
